CPU comparisonAMD Phenom II X4 850 or AMD EPYC 7452 - which processor is faster? In this comparison we look at the differences and analyze which of these two CPUs is better. We compare the technical data and benchmark results.
The AMD Phenom II X4 850 has 4 cores with 4 threads and clocks with a maximum frequency of 3.30 GHz. Up to GB of memory is supported in 2 memory channels. The AMD Phenom II X4 850 was released in Q2/2011. The AMD EPYC 7452 has 32 cores with 64 threads and clocks with a maximum frequency of 3.35 GHz. The CPU supports up to GB of memory in 8 memory channels. The AMD EPYC 7452 was released in Q3/2019. |

CPU Cores and Base FrequencyThe AMD Phenom II X4 850 has 4 CPU cores and can calculate 4 threads in parallel. The clock frequency of the AMD Phenom II X4 850 is 3.30 GHz while the AMD EPYC 7452 has 32 CPU cores and 64 threads can calculate simultaneously. The clock frequency of the AMD EPYC 7452 is at 2.35 GHz (3.35 GHz). |

Memory & PCIeThe AMD Phenom II X4 850 can use up to GB of memory in 2 memory channels. The maximum memory bandwidth is 21.3 GB/s. The AMD EPYC 7452 supports up to GB of memory in 8 memory channels and achieves a memory bandwidth of up to 51.2 GB/s. |

Thermal ManagementThe thermal design power (TDP for short) of the AMD Phenom II X4 850 is 95 W, while the AMD EPYC 7452 has a TDP of 155 W. The TDP specifies the necessary cooling solution that is required to cool the processor sufficiently. |

Technical detailsThe AMD Phenom II X4 850 is manufactured in 45 nm and has 2.00 MB cache. The AMD EPYC 7452 is manufactured in 7 nm and has a 128.00 MB cache. |
